# FDA recall Z-2657-2023

> **Medtronic Neuromodulation** · Class II · device recall initiated 2020-07-17.

## Product

Restore  Clinician Programmer Application Software, model number A71100, used with the Restore Neurostimulators.

## Reason for recall

The original version of the A71100 Restore Clinician Programmer Application has been identified to have a compatibility issue with some legacy clinician programmer software resulting in the programmer having an inability to establish communication with the implanted neurostimulators.

## Distribution

Worldwide distribution - US Nationwide (there was government and military distribution) and the countries of Australia and Singapore.
